The Body Doesn't Heal Without Sleep
When we rest, our bodies enter into repair setting. Muscle mass recuperate, cells regrow, and our body immune system reinforces. It's a time when the body detoxifies and recovers. But when sleep is shortened or when it's consistently low quality, this whole process is disrupted.
Gradually, a lack of proper rest can lead to damaged resistance, making you a lot more prone to illnesses. Also wounds recover more gradually when you're sleep-deprived. Chronic poor rest has actually likewise been linked to a greater risk of developing long-lasting health and wellness problems like heart disease, diabetic issues, and hypertension.
A good night's remainder isn't a deluxe-- it's a requirement for the body to operate correctly.

Emotional Resilience Depends on Quality Rest
Ever before discover how your perseverance frays after a bad night's sleep? That's no coincidence. Rest and feelings are deeply linked.
When you're well-rested, you're better outfitted to regulate your emotions and respond to difficult scenarios. Without sleep, small hassles can really feel overwhelming. This happens due to the fact that the brain's psychological center comes to be over active, while the area responsible for logical thinking decreases.
Mood swings, impatience, anxiety, and even depressive episodes can all be connected to poor sleep. Emotional security depends on obtaining regular, deep remainder. And if interrupted sleep ends up being a pattern, it may be time to explore if a much deeper problem goes to play.

Hormone Imbalance and Weight Gain
Yes, rest affects your weight-- and not even if you're too worn out to hit the health club.
Sleep plays a major role in controling the hormonal agents that control cravings and metabolic rate. When you're sleep-deprived, your body produces more ghrelin (the appetite hormone) and less leptin (the hormonal agent that makes you feel complete). This imbalance usually results in enhanced cravings and unhealthy food choices.
In addition, chronic poor rest can hinder insulin sensitivity, boosting the threat of type 2 diabetic issues. Your body's capability to control blood glucose counts greatly on rest, making it important for total metabolic wellness.
